Work on to construct Dhyana Mandapam in Thiyaganur village in Thalaivasal Taluk in the district is nearing completion and expected to be over in a few months.
A large sculpture of a lotus flower in full bloom would be constructed inside the mandapam and the 11th century Buddha statue would be placed on it.
The structure was estimated to cost Rs. 50 lakh and funds were mobilized from industrialists and voluntary contributors.
The mandapam is expected to attract tourists in large numbers as people visiting Bhairavar Temple in Aragalur would also visit the mandapam.
The statue had been lying in an agricultural field without maintenance over the past centuries.
Efforts by local villagers led to the implementation of the project with the support of the district administration.
Collector K. Maharabushanam visited the works along with District Revenue Officer N. Prasanna Venaktesan, Revenue Divisional Officer (Attur) Muthuramalingam and contributors on Thursday. Mr. Maharabushanam said that once the mandapam was completed, the place would be converted into a tourist spot and basic infrastructure would be created.
